David Büsser

Partner, designer

David (he/him) sees design as the ideal and most efficient tool to drive sustainable development. He is deeply committed to creating a more social, tolerant, and just world. As a technology-savvy designer and consultant, David operates at the intersection of strategy, design, and technology. He is known for his cross-media expertise, extensive experience in visual communication and branding, as well as his proficiency in experience and service design. Before founding Reform in 2012, David worked for agencies both domestically and internationally. His work has received international recognition, including awards such as the German Design Award and the Red Dot Award.

Sarra Ganouchi

Managing director, partner, designer

Sarra (she/her) is dedicated to driving positive change with her infectious optimism, and she loves to inspire others to do the same. Since 2020, she has been a partner and managing director at Reform. She brings together extensive entrepreneurial experience with expertise in strategic design, regenerative development, and circular design. After completing her bachelor’s and master’s degrees in design at the Zurich University of the Arts, she founded a branding agency and her own circular design-inspired textile company, fouta – everyday towels made to last. Sarra has played a significant role in shaping Reform’s realignment and values, leading the company to become a certified B Corp. As an RSA Fellow, Nominator in the circular design category at the Design Preis Schweiz, co-initiator of the Circular Design Circle, and the SEEK association, Sarra is committed to social progress, sustainability, and regeneration.

Selina Hotz

Consultant for organizational development

Selina (she/her) is a consultant with a wholehearted approach. With her empathetic nature and analytical skills, she guides organizations in integrating effective collaborative work practices into their daily routines and developing offerings, structures, and solutions that cater to the needs of people. After obtaining her master’s degree in psychology from the University of Bern, Selina gained extensive experience in change management and has since been using her expertise to support companies in implementing substantive, structural, and cultural transformations. Alongside her partners at Purpose Schweiz, she assists companies in adopting the principles of steward-ownership as the legal ownership structure for their organizations.

Simon Widmer

Consultant for circular design and regenerative design

Simon (he/him) is a compassionate and enthusiastic expert in circular design, infusing his projects with a deep connection to nature and his background in yoga. After working as a strategy consultant at McKinsey & Company, he spent 7 years at the Ellen MacArthur Foundation, co-developing the Circular Design Program and the Circular Design Guide. Today, he is an independent and experienced circular design consultant with an M.A. in strategy and international management, as well as an M.Sc, CEMS master in international management from the University of St.Gallen (HSG). In addition to his consultancy work, Simon also works as a project manager at ecos, contributing to shaping an innovation platform, and as an RSA Fellow, he is dedicated to social progress and the exchange of ideas and innovations.
